Webf ( f-1(x) ) = x Example: Start with: f-1(11) = (11-3)/2 = 4 And then: f (4) = 2×4+3 = 11 So we can say: f ( f-1(11) ) = 11 "f of f inverse of 11 equals 11" Solve Using Algebra We can work out the inverse using Algebra. Put "y" for "f (x)" and solve for x: This method works well for more difficult inverses. Fahrenheit to Celsius
